Actually fix the long lines display bug (bug#56393).
* src/dispextern.h (struct it): New 'narrowed_begv' field.
* src/dispextern.h (WITH_NARROWED_BEGV): New macro.
* src/xdisp.c (get_narrowed_begv): New function.
(init_iterator): Initilize the 'narrowed_begv' field.
(back_to_previous_line_start, get_visually_first_element,
move_it_vertically_backward): Use the new macro.
* src/dispextern.h: Prototype of 'get_narrowed_begv'.
* src/window.c (window_body_height): Make it externally visible.
* src/window.h: Prototype of 'window_body_height'.
* src/composite.c (find_automatic_composition): Optimize display in buffers
with very long lines with 'get_narrowed_begv'.
* lisp/obsolete/longlines.el: Reobsolete longlines-mode.
* etc/NEWS: Announce the new minor mode, and remove the unobsoletion
indication for 'longlines-mode'.
* doc/emacs/trouble.texi (Long Lines): Remove the section.
(Lossage): Remove the entry for the Long Lines section.
* doc/emacs/emacs.texi (Top): Remove the entry for the Long Lines section.
